Transaction f96c0e2a481aed226af81f6109443c90b67ac57fd14ad7e936cc6eb0c64894ee
1 Input
1 Output
-
f96c0e2a481aed226af81f6109443c90b67ac57fd14ad7e936cc6eb0c64894ee:0
- value
- 21626136
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6dba2a8a2e8c39149a85357c9d30f81bb1edeb6a OP_EQUAL
- address
- 3BhCbWH5bJuAS6JQzJRNJj56pKFkcEc6n4